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ew

Step 1: Brew the Cold Brew Coffee
Start by making the cold brew coffee, using a medium-dark roast for a bold flavor. Coarsely grind the coffee beans and steep them in cold water for about 12-24 hours, depending on your preference for strength. Once brewed, strain the mixture through a coffee filter or fine mesh sieve, then chill it in the refrigerator until ready to use.

Step 2: Prepare the Miso Caramel Syrup
In a medium saucepan over medium heat, add granulated sugar and allow it to melt without stirring. Watch closely as it transforms to a deep amber color, which should take about 8-10 minutes. Once the desired color is achieved, remove it from heat and carefully whisk in miso paste and cream until smooth. Let the syrup cool slightly before using it in the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ew.

Step 3: Make the Cold Foam
Pour your choice of cream or milk into a chilled bowl. Using a hand mixer or whisk, beat the cream until soft peaks form, which should take about 3-5 minutes. For best results, ensure the bowl and beaters are cold to achieve a light, airy texture. This cold foam will add a delightful creaminess to your finished drink.

Step 4: Assemble the Drink
Grab a tall glass and pour in the chilled cold brew coffee. Next, drizzle in a generous amount of the miso caramel syrup, creating a beautiful layering effect. Stir gently to combine the syrup with the coffee, balancing the sweet and savory flavors for your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ew.

Step 5: Top with Cold Foam and Finish
Spoon the whipped cold foam over the coffee and syrup mixture, allowing it to float nicely on top. For a flavorful finish, sprinkle a touch of flaky sea salt over the foam. This final touch enhances the contrasting flavors, making your drink irresistible and visually appealing.

Storage Tips for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ew

  • Fridge: Store leftover miso caramel syrup in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 1 week to maintain its flavor and freshness.
  • Cold Brew Coffee: Keep any remaining cold brew coffee in a sealed jar in the refrigerator for up to 5 days; it’s perfect for a quick morning pick-me-up.
  • Cold Foam: Whip the cold foam fresh for best texture; however, if you have some leftover, store it in the fridge for up to 2 days but be aware it may lose some volume.
  • Reheating: If you prefer your coffee warm, gently heat the cold brew on the stove, stirring to combine; just avoid boiling to keep the flavor balanced in your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ew.

Expert Tips for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ew

Monitor Sugar Closely: Make sure to keep an eye on the sugar as it melts; a deep amber color is key, but burning can happen quickly.

Chill Your Equipment: Use a cold bowl and beaters for whipping the cold foam; this helps achieve a better volume and stability for your Salted Miso Caramel Cold Foam Cold Brew.

Experiment with Miso: Don’t be afraid to try different types of miso paste! Lighter miso will add sweetness, while darker varieties bring stronger umami flavors.

How can I troubleshoot if my cold foam isn’t forming?
If your cold foam isn’t whipping up as expected, here’s a step-by-step guide:

  1. Chill Your Equipment: Start with a chilled bowl and beaters. Cold equipment helps the cream whip up faster and achieve better volume.
  2. Use High-Fat Cream: Ensure you’re using heavy cream or a creamy alternative for the best results. Lower-fat options may not whip as well.
  3. Beat Until Soft Peaks Form: After about 3-5 minutes, you should see soft peaks forming. Don’t rush it! If you’re using a hand mixer, start at lower speeds and gradually increase.

Ingredients
  

For the Cold Brew
  • 2 cups Cold Brew Coffee Medium-dark roast for bold flavor
For the Miso Caramel Syrup
  • 1 cup Granulated Sugar Cook until deep amber color
  • 2 tablespoons Miso Paste Experiment with white or red miso
  • 1/2 cup Cream Use heavy cream or half-and-half
For the Cold Foam
  • 1/2 cup Cream or Milk Whip until soft peaks form
For the Finishing Touch
  • 1 teaspoon Sea Salt Flaky sea salt enhances flavor

Equipment

  • medium saucepan
  • Hand Mixer or Whisk
  • Coffee filter or fine mesh sieve
  • Tall Glass
  • Chilled Bowl

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Brew the Cold Brew Coffee: Coarsely grind coffee beans and steep in cold water for 12-24 hours. Strain and chill.
  2. Prepare the Miso Caramel Syrup: Melt sugar in a saucepan over medium heat until amber, then whisk in miso and cream.
  3. Make the Cold Foam: Whip cream or milk in a chilled bowl until soft peaks form.
  4. Assemble the Drink: Pour cold brew into a glass, drizzle with miso caramel syrup, and stir gently.
  5. Top with Cold Foam and Finish: Spoon cold foam over the drink and sprinkle with sea salt.
